Lake LBJ holds a unique distinction among the Highland Lakes chain—it's a constant-level lake, meaning water levels stay consistent year-round regardless of drought conditions. For Labor Day weekend visitors, this translates to reliable boating, swimming, and water sports right through the end of summer.
The lake stretches over 6,000 acres and offers 21 miles of waterway to explore. September water temperatures typically hover in the low-to-mid 80s, making it ideal for swimming, tubing, and kayaking without the intense summer heat that can make midday activities uncomfortable. The air temperatures begin to ease slightly too, offering more pleasant conditions for outdoor dining and evening gatherings on the deck.
Beyond the water, the Texas Hill Country surrounding Kingsland delivers that laid-back atmosphere that makes vacation feel like a true escape. Small-town charm mixes with easy access to restaurants, boat rentals, and outdoor recreation. You're close enough to Austin (about an hour's drive) for day trips, yet far enough to leave the city chaos behind.

One of the best things about Labor Day weekend on Lake LBJ? There's no shortage of ways to enjoy the water and surrounding area, whether your group craves adrenaline-pumping action or peaceful relaxation.
Boat rentals are available from several marinas in the Kingsland area, offering everything from pontoon boats (perfect for leisurely cruises with kids and coolers) to speedboats for tubing and wakeboarding. The constant-level lake means you won't encounter the exposed stumps and unpredictable conditions that can plague other Texas lakes late in summer.
Kayaking and paddleboarding offer a quieter way to explore the coves and shoreline. Early morning paddles before the boat traffic picks up provide almost meditative experiences, with chances to spot herons, turtles, and the occasional deer drinking at the water's edge.
Fishing enthusiasts should note that Lake LBJ holds healthy populations of largemouth bass, catfish, and sunfish. September can be productive as fish become more active with the slight temperature drop. Check out our tips for fishing and group getaways if angling is on your agenda.
When you're ready to dry off, the Texas Hill Country delivers plenty of adventure. Longhorn Cavern State Park offers fascinating underground tours through ancient limestone formations—a cool escape (literally, at 68 degrees year-round inside the cavern) from the September warmth. Reservations are recommended for holiday weekends.
Golfers in your group will appreciate the properties near Legends Golf Course on Lake LBJ, where morning tee times offer stunning views and well-maintained greens.
For nature lovers, Inks Lake State Park provides hiking trails, swimming areas, and stunning scenery. If your group includes outdoors enthusiasts, consider browsing vacation rentals near Inks Lake State Park to position yourself perfectly for trail access.

Holiday weekends come with unique considerations. Keep these tips in mind for smooth sailing:
Book Your Boat Early: Rental companies get swamped with Labor Day requests. If boating is essential to your plans, reserve at least 2-3 weeks ahead. The same goes for restaurant reservations at popular spots.
Bring Essentials: While Kingsland has basic shopping, stock up on specialty items before you arrive. Sunscreen, lake toys, fishing gear, and your favorite beverages are easier to grab in Austin than to hunt down last minute.
Plan for Traffic: Expect heavier-than-usual traffic heading out of Austin on Friday afternoon and returning Monday evening. An early departure or late return can save you significant highway frustration.
Respect the Lake: Labor Day marks the unofficial end of summer, and Lake LBJ sees higher boat traffic than usual. Practice lake safety, keep noise levels reasonable for neighbors, and leave the shoreline cleaner than you found it.
Embrace Flexibility: Group travel means adjusting expectations. Build buffer time into your plans and remain open to spontaneous changes—sometimes the best memories come from unplanned adventures.
